Chapter 1298 Too Many Bad Deeds, Retribution Comes
She grabbed Ann and yanked the scarf off her neck.
Ann had a rough night and overslept this morning. She had stayed over at that guy's place and completely forgot to set an alarm. By the time she got the call that Connie was causing a scene at the office, it was already too late.
The marks on her neck were instantly exposed. Connie even pulled down her shirt to make sure everyone could see them clearly.
"Look at this! This tramp didn't come to work because she was with another guy. Who knows how many guys she's been with? These marks are from those random dudes. It's disgusting! I couldn't take it anymore, so I came to the office to report her. Look at her! Working with someone like this, aren't you afraid of catching something?" Connie
called out.
"Mom!"
Ann was feeling unwell, having just started her period that morning. She was weak and tried to pull her shirt back up, but Connie slapped her.
Connie used to work in manual labor and had a strong hand. Ann, already in poor health, couldn't dodge it.
The people on the top floor saw the marks and their expressions changed.
Everyone started to believe Connie's words. Otherwise, where did those marks come from?
But no one had heard about Ann having a boyfriend. Just a few days ago, when a male colleague from the top floor pursued her, she said she was single.
Yet, with so many marks on her body, it was clear she had a wild night.
Ann usually acted so reserved, but the contrast was shocking.
People started whispering among themselves. Selena, who couldn't see, had no idea what was happening. She only heard Connie slapping Ann.
She leaned back slightly against Raymond and quietly asked, "What's going on?"
Why did everyone on the top floor suddenly start whispering, and why was Ann the subject of their gossip? Did Ann really do something like that?
Impossible!
"She has marks from sleeping with a man."
Raymond answered bluntly, while Connie continued her tirade.
Calling her all sorts of vile names.
"Shut up!" Selena shouted. She was furious and then called for security.
Connie became even more smug, especially with Ann present. She knew Ann would side with her.
"Ann, tell your boss I'm telling the truth. I'm your mother, after all. Are you really going to have security throw me out? Don't ever call me or send me money again. Never come home."
Ann was a woman with no one to rely on. The monthly phone call and the money she sent were her only connections to the world. It was her lifeline.
Just like Selena thought of Barbara to get through tough times, Ann relied on that phone call to keep going.

She didn't care how much Connie hated her. As long as she sent money every month, Connie would be somewhat kind when she answered the phone.
She knew it was wrong, but she couldn't resist the pull of family.
She must have some psychological issues.
Selena didn't hear Ann's voice and was puzzled. After being accused like that, was Ann really not going to respond?noveldrama
"Ann?" Selena spoke up.
As soon as she spoke, she heard Ann's choked voice, "Ms. Fair, my mom and I have a misunderstanding. I'll take her away and come back to hand over my work."
"You're quitting?"
"I... I don't know."
Ann's eyes showed confusion. She really didn't know.
Without that phone call, she didn't know where she would go or how she would live. She just felt so tired.
Selena reached out, trying to grab her hand.

The people on the top floor finally noticed something was wrong with her eyes.
"Ms. Fair, what's wrong with your eyes?"
"Ms. Fair, are you okay?"
"Are you blind? When will you recover? Ms. Fair, don't scare us."
Everyone stopped focusing on Ann's gossip and started worrying about Selena's health.
Selena had founded the company herself, and everyone on the top floor admired her. Now their hearts were in their throats.
"I'm fine. Don't worry. Ann, come to my office and explain everything," Selena said.
After saying that, she took Raymond's hand. "Raymond, have someone restrain Ann's mom. If she dares to curse again, find any reason to lock her man up for ten days or so."
Connie's pupils shrank. She knew Ann's weak spot, but now it seemed Ann's boss knew hers.
Connie's face turned ugly. She wanted to argue but didn't dare after meeting Raymond's gaze. She just muttered.
"You're finally paying for all your wickedness, you blind witch!" Connie exclaimed.
But Selena, already being led into the office by Ann, didn't hear this.
She didn't hear it, but Raymond did.
